    Off the top of my head I think Control 5 Plus is 180watts sensitivity 90db frequency response, hold on a sec…got and old JBL Control series broacher here in front of me that I was talking about last year I think.

    Frequency 45Hz to 20Khz
    Power 180watts
    Sensitivity 89db
    Impedance 4 ohms
    Crossover 2KHz

    8 inch bass mid
    2 inch titanium dome tweeter

    The Control 5 with a larger bass driver. More bass for critical listening applications.
